What is the percentage increase/decrease from 5510 to 41273?

Answer: The percentage change is 649.06%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 5510 to 41273?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 5510\)
• \(Y = 41273\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({41273-5510 \over 5510}\) = \({35763 \over 5510}\) = \(6.4905626134301\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(6.4906\) = \(649.06 \over 100 \) = \(649.06\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 649.06%.
